KC – MidMO Challenge Golf Tournament Results


With over 3.5” of rain in the past 4 days, we knew conditions would be tough on the course.  Luckily the weather cooperated with us, and we had mild temps, a light breeze, and some sunshine to finish off a great event at Mules National Golf Course for the MidMo Challenge.  Players from Kansas City, Columbia, Springfield, Topeka, St Louis and Iowa all came down to complete a field of 88 players for this fantastic golf course!

In Division 1, Jacob Dittmer looked like he was going to run away with it, playing solid golf all day long.  But he wasn’t aware that Larry Langley and Corey Buford were creeping up on him in the background.  Jacob continued to play solid golf, while Larry lost a little energy and stumbled the last few holes, finding the water twice on the 18th green.  Corey Buford started slow, with 3 bogeys in a row, but bounced back on the back 9 shooting a 1 over 36 on the back, and 4 over on the day.  Jacob finished with a bogey after finding the island green off the tee on 18, to shoot a 1 over 71 and take the win by 3.

Division 2 was full of fireworks coming down the stretch!  After 16 holes, Tyler Reynolds had a 2 stroke lead over Chris O’Dowd and a 3 stroke lead over Cole Lehman.  An untimely triple bogey at the 17th for Tyler, and a water ball off the tee on 18 for Chris meant Chris was one back of Tyler in the clubhouse.  Tyler needed to par 18 to have the clubhouse lead, and he did just that, leaving it up to Cole to par for the playoff.  Cole found the green, and a solid two putt saw him and Tyler go back to the 18th tee and try it over again.  Cole found the center of the green, pin high 20’ to the left, while Tyler’s ball found the water.  Tyler hit his next shot 15’ short of the pin, and Cole cozied up his first putt for an easy tap in and the victory.

Division 3 was a great battle between home course favorite Matthew Morgan and Brian Lunt out of Kearney.  Matthew had a one shot lead after the front 9 shooting a solid score of 5 over par.  A double on the 11th for Morgan, and back to back pars to start the back for Lunt meant Lunt had the one stroke lead.  Morgan finished the back 9 with only one more bogey, while Lunt faltered a bit with a double on 12 followed by a few bogeys.  Lunt would ultimately fall short of Morgan, carding a still impressive 81, but Morgan came out victorious with an 8 over par 78.

Division 4 was a rollercoaster!!  Kyle Bauer led after the front 9 at 5 over par, with Todd Gurss and Chris Young right on his heels at 6 over par.  The back 9 was a wild ride for some of these guys!  Andrew Zeigler was 3 back at the turn, but while the others struggled on the back 9, Ziggy found his groove and carded an impressive 6 over par back 9, while, Young, Gurss and Bauer carded a 10 over, 11 over and 12 par respectively to make Ziggy a back to back winner on the APT!

Division 5 was another Paul Orovets show!  Even in the wet conditions, Paul was able to maintain his cool and keep Leroy Barnes and Rocky Metcalfe in his rear view mirror all day.  Paul had a couple stumbles on the back 9, but had built a solid lead on the front 9 with 7 over par, and was able to keep his chasers at bay.  Like Ziggy, this makes Paul another back to back winner on tour this season!  Paul is looking forward to hopefully moving up to D4 as his game steadily improves!
